The genus name is derived from the Ancient Greek ἄρχων (árkhōn), meaning "chieftain" or "ruler", combined with the palm genus Phoenix, and refers to the regal stature of the trees. The species epithet is given in honour of Princess Alexandra of Denmark. To the untrained eye, a King and Queen Palm may look identical, but there are a few easy-to-spot attributes that only a Queen Palm will have.

USDA hardiness zones 10 to 12 allow for the year-round planting of this species. Choose a spot that gets some to full sun. The area should have adequate room to support complete growth. Select a location where there are no overhead power lines or other barriers when the plant is at its full height. At least 12 to 15 feet should be left between each planting. The soil must be sandy and well-draining for this plant. The King Palm has a crownshaft and the Queen Palm does not. The Queen’s fronds are fluffy with irregular leaflets while the King is more organized. The Queen’s fruits are orange and ellipsoid while the King’s are round and red. King palms have limited cold tolerance and can be damaged or killed by freezing temperatures. They are best suited for USDA hardiness zones 9 to 11, where winter temperatures rarely drop below 20°F (-6°C). Do king palms require a lot of water? Since it is a tropical plant, this palm tree grows best in warm, humid climates. It can withstand temperatures as low as 30°F but likes temperatures ranging from 60°F to 80°F.
